Revolutionizing Music Discovery: YouTube Music’s Latest Feature

On September 11, 2024, YouTube Music unveiled an innovative feature aimed at transforming the way users discover their favorite songs. Known as Ask Music, this new tool leverages generative artificial intelligence to curate personalized playlists based solely on user input.

Although currently in the testing stage, Ask Music has started to gain traction among music enthusiasts. Users are able to type in simple phrases like “upbeat pop tracks” and immediately receive a customized playlist complete with an original title and a description of the musical selections included.

As of now, Ask Music is available exclusively to YouTube Premium members, with trials taking place in markets including the United States, Canada, and Australia, particularly on Android devices. The feature is expected to utilize the advanced technology from Google’s Gemini chatbot, with plans to expand its availability to iOS devices shortly.

This launch occurs at a competitive time for YouTube Music, as it strives to keep pace with Spotify, which introduced its own AI-generated personalized playlists in April 2024. What Is Ask Music?
Ask Music is a generative AI-powered tool that allows YouTube Music users to describe the type of music they want, resulting in a personalized playlist that aligns with their mood and preferences. Users can simply input phrases like “relaxing acoustic jams” or “dance tracks for a party” to receive a tailored selection of songs.

Key Questions About Ask Music

1. **How does Ask Music curate playlists differently than traditional algorithms?**
Answer: Traditional algorithms often rely on user history and predefined categories. Ask Music utilizes natural language processing to interpret user intent and preferences in a more nuanced way, providing a unique combination of tracks based on contextual phrases rather than simple genre tags.

2. **Who can access Ask Music?**
Answer: Currently, Ask Music is available exclusively to YouTube Premium members, with testing mostly in the United States, Canada, and Australia on Android devices. Expansion to iOS is expected imminently.
